Before downloading from game sites, and before getting involved in instant messaging, make sure you have up to date virus protection and malware protection. Check out AVG antivirus and Spybot. There are links for those two freeware programs on this site under the Cybersafety forum.
When downloading, and you get the message prompting you to save to disk, you browse to a folder(directory) on your computers hard drive and, if necessary, make a sub-folder(directory) which you would then double click on to open and then click save. YOu need to make note of the path(location) of the directory you have saved to befory you click save so you can find it again. You generally then double click on the saved file in the location you saved it to to install the downloaded program. You may then have to tell it where to install it to.
